Governor Mbah’s Infrastructure, Security Investments are Attracting Diaspora Investors, Says Abike Dabiri-Erewa

Ferdy Agu 

Enugu State Governor, Dr. Peter Mbah, has called on Nigerians in the diaspora to prioritize Enugu as their investment destination, emphasizing that his administration has implemented effective mechanisms to streamline investment processes and guarantee attractive returns.

The governor made this appeal during a sensitization and advocacy workshop in Enugu, jointly organized by the Nigerians in Diaspora Commission (NiDCOM) and the Enugu State Government, to promote diaspora investment opportunities in Southeast Nigeria.

Speaking through the Secretary to the State Government, Prof. Chidiebere Onyia, Governor Mbah lauded the immense contributions of the Nigerian diaspora to national development through remittances, expertise, and innovation. He highlighted the strategic importance of engaging the diaspora community for sustainable economic growth.

“With an estimated $20 billion to $25 billion remitted annually by Nigerians abroad, as estimated by the World Bank, the diaspora community is indispensable. Harnessing their support and influence is key to fostering investment, trade, and stronger global networks,” Mbah stated.

Mbah outlined several initiatives his administration has launched to position Enugu as a business-friendly state. These include guaranteed land access, transparency in governance, and a secure investment environment. He further urged Igbo investors abroad to embrace the spirit of homecoming and actively contribute to the development of the Southeast region.

“The Southeast is globally recognized for its entrepreneurial drive, industrious spirit, and strong commitment to community development. Ndigbo in the diaspora must seize this opportunity to invest in the region, not only financially but also socially, to drive sustainable growth,” he added.

He reiterated his administration’s ambitious goal of increasing the state’s GDP from $4.4 billion to $30 billion. Diaspora investments, Mbah noted, would play a pivotal role in achieving this target while improving the quality of life for Enugu residents.

Highlighting ongoing projects that offer lucrative investment prospects, Mbah mentioned the Enugu State Electricity Market, the New Enugu Smart City, Special Agro-Processing Zones, ICT initiatives, and transport infrastructure projects, among others. These projects, he said, span critical sectors such as agriculture, technology, education, energy, and mineral resources.

Chairman of NiDCOM, Mrs. Abike Dabiri-Erewa, commended Governor Mbah’s dedication to infrastructural development and security, emphasizing that such efforts create a conducive environment for diaspora investments. She urged Nigerians abroad to leverage these opportunities for mutual benefit.

“There is no better place to invest than one’s home. Many of the respected diasporans hail from Enugu State and are excelling globally. Now is the time to reinvest in their roots,” Dabiri-Erewa said.

She proposed the establishment of a diaspora fund to channel investments into sectors with high returns, stressing that all Southeast states possess unique opportunities for diaspora investors.

The Special Adviser to the Governor on Diaspora Matters, Mrs. Olangwa Ezekwu, reiterated the administration’s commitment to creating a business-friendly environment. She outlined potential investment areas, including education, security, agriculture, tourism, health, mining, and ICT, among others.

“This is a call to action. The state is ready to partner with you in various sectors to achieve sustainable development. Join us in this journey and claim your seat at the table as we work together to advance the Southeast region,” Ezekwu urged.
